Ghardaia vs Byrd Climate & Distance Between

Antarctica flag
  • The distance between Ghardaia, Algeria and Byrd, Antarctica is approximately 14,173 km or 8,807 mi.
  • To reach Ghardaia in this distance one would set out from Byrd bearing 117.3°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ghardaia bearing 10.5° or N .
  • Ghardaia has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Byrd has a ice cap climate (EF).
  • The mean temperature is 49.4 °C (88.9°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.9 °C (1.6°F) less in Ghardaia.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 31.7 mm (1.2 in) more which is equivalent to 31.7 l/m² (0.78 US gal/ft²) or 317,000 l/ha (33,889 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 48.2° higher in Ghardaia than in Byrd.
